Abstract
Liquidus-phase equilibrium data of the present authors for the PbO-ZnO -SiO2 system, combined with phase equilibrium and thermodynamic data f rom the literature, were optimized to obtain a self-consistent set of parameters of thermodynamic models for all phases. The modified quasic hemical model was used for the liquid slag phase. From these model par ameters, the optimized ternary-phase diagram was back-calculated.
